Responsibilities
- Promote Safety: Take an active role prioritizing safety for yourself and others to ensure all assigned plants have zero accidents and are in total compliance with all Vulcan policies and procedures.
- Organize and Plan Production: Plan the daily operation scheduling of plant production to ensure optimal utilization of plant equipment, personnel, and inventory requirements. Ensure optimal utilization of work procedures in regards to stripping, mining, processing, stockpiling, loading, and shipping. Maintain responsibility for all aspects of site planning and pit development.
- Manage Employee Relations: Provide strong leadership, training, team building, and supervision to all employees at the plant. Work cross-functionally with HR to recruit new employees, provide merit increases, perform disciplinary actions, and evaluate employee performance to develop talent.
- Monitor Processes and Materials: Analyze production and quality control to ensure a quality product for customers. Monitor operational reports to ensure best practices in extraction, processing, stockpiling, and re-handling, keeping product within target specifications. Implement and monitor a preventive maintenance program to limit work stoppages, downtime, and other disruptions.
- Ensure Economic Profit: Manage financial decisions for the plant, including budgets, forecasts, inventory management, and labor and capital planning to ensure adherence to all budgets and financial goals. Seek improvement activities to reduce costs and improve operating efficiency across the plant.
- Maintain Compliance: Build a strong safety culture to ensure the plant complies with Vulcan’s safety, operations, and environmental policies and procedures. Manage the health and safety of employees to continuously improve Vulcan’s health & safety performance.
- Additional Responsibilities: Other duties as assigned.
Requirements
- Experience in supervising production employees at an aggregate, sand/gravel, or asphalt plant is preferred.
- Strong leadership and management skills to motivate and maintain social relationships among employees.
- Operational knowledge of rock and sand mining, ready-mix concrete and/or asphalt operations and equipment, MSHA regulations, engineering principles and procedures, and quality control systems and processes.
- Excellent interpersonal skills, including the ability to motivate and build teams, and effectively communicate with both internal and external audiences.
- Financial knowledge and experience managing financial performance to established targets.
- Flexibility to work outside in all types of weather conditions and tolerate exposure to loud noises.
